标题中的"linguars-0.1.2-cp36-abi3-win_amd64.whl"是一个Python的轮子文件(wheel file),它是Python软件包的一种二进制分发格式,旨在简化安装过程。这个文件的具体信息如下: 1. **linguars**:这是Python库的名称,它可能是一个用于处理语言或文本数据的库,尽管没有提供库的具体功能,我们可以推测它可能涉及自然语言处理、词法分析或类似的功能。 2. **0.1.2**:这是库的版本号,表示这是linguars库的第三次修订,属于它的第一个主要版本的小更新。 3. **cp36**:这代表该轮子文件是为Python 3.6版本编译的。'cp'代表'CPython',即标准的Python解释器,而'36'指的是3.6这个特定的版本。 4. **abi3**:ABI(Application Binary Interface)是指应用程序二进制接口,abi3表示此轮子文件是跨Python 3.2及以上版本的兼容接口。这意味着在3.2及以后的Python 3版本中,无需重新编译即可使用。 5. **win_amd64**:这个部分表明该文件是为Windows操作系统上的64位(AMD64)架构设计的。 描述中提到,这是一个可以解压后使用的Python库资源,意味着用户可以通过Python的包管理工具如pip来安装这个轮子文件,而不是手动解压和安装。 关于Python库的使用和管理,以下是一些相关知识点: - **pip**:Python的默认包管理器,用于安装、升级和卸载Python库。用户可以通过命令`pip install linguars-0.1.2-cp36-abi3-win_amd64.whl`来安装这个库。 - **环境管理**:Python的虚拟环境(venv或conda environments)允许用户为每个项目创建独立的Python环境,避免库版本冲突。安装前应确保在合适的环境中执行安装命令。 - **依赖管理**:库可能有其自身的依赖项。在安装linguars时,pip会自动处理这些依赖,如果它们包含在轮子文件中或者可以从PyPI(Python Package Index)获取。 - **版本控制**:库的版本号管理遵循 Semantic Versioning(语义化版本)规范,如`MAJOR.MINOR.PATCH`。这里的0.1.2意味着一个主要功能尚未改变的次要更新,修复了一些小问题。 - **源代码与二进制分发**:Python库既可以通过源代码(如.tar.gz或.zip文件)分发,也可以通过二进制形式(如.whl文件)分发。二进制分发通常更快,因为它们已经针对特定平台编译。 - **Python的兼容性**:'abi3'标记表明linguars库试图与多个Python 3.x版本兼容。但是,对于某些特定功能,库可能需要特定版本的Python。 - **软件包结构**:一个Python库通常包含`.py`源代码文件、测试用例、文档、配置文件等。轮子文件在内部封装了这些结构,使得用户无需查看源代码即可安装和使用。 综上,linguars是一个针对Python 3.6的文本处理库,用户可以通过pip轻松安装。了解如何管理和使用Python库对于进行Python开发至关重要,因为它能够帮助我们高效地利用社区资源,实现各种功能。
- 1
- 粉丝: 14w+
- 资源: 15万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助